# Model Card for lianghsun/Llama-3.2-Taiwan-3B-Instruct

![image/png](https://cdn-uploads.huggingface.co/production/uploads/618dc56cbc345ca7bf95f3cd/v_cfMxTtVE6_eh0rzcy5L.png)
*圖像生成來自 [OpenArt](https://openart.ai/home):An anime-style 🦙 standing proudly atop the summit of Taiwan’s [Yushan (Jade Mountain)](https://zh.wikipedia.org/wiki/%E7%8E%89%E5%B1%B1), gazing forward.*

採用 [lianghsun/Llama-3.2-Taiwan-3B](https://huggingface.co/lianghsun/Llama-3.2-Taiwan-3B) 為[基礎模型(foundation model)](https://en.wikipedia.org/wiki/Foundation_model),使用大量[中華民國台灣](https://zh.wikipedia.org/zh-tw/%E8%87%BA%E7%81%A3)的繁體中文對話集和多國語言對話集進行模型[指令微調(instruction fine-tuning)](https://www.ibm.com/topics/instruction-tuning)和多輪迭代[直接偏好優化(direct preference optimization, DPO)](https://arxiv.org/abs/2305.18290),旨在訓練出具有中華民國台灣知識及風格的[小語言模型(small langugae model, SLM)](https://www.ibm.com/think/topics/small-language-models)之對話模型。

## How to Get Started with the Model

要使用 [vLLM Docker image](https://docs.vllm.ai/en/latest/serving/deploying_with_docker.html) 來啟動此模型,您可以按照以下操作:
```bash
docker run --runtime nvidia --gpus all \
    -v ~/.cache/huggingface:/root/.cache/huggingface \
    --env "HUGGING_FACE_HUB_TOKEN=<secret>" \
    -p 8000:8000 \
    --ipc=host \
    vllm/vllm-openai:latest \
    --model lianghsun/Llama-3.2-Taiwan-3B-Instruct
```

請注意,如果想要使用不同版本的 checkpoint,請加上 `--revision <tag_name>` 
```bash
docker run --runtime nvidia --gpus all \
    -v ~/.cache/huggingface:/root/.cache/huggingface \
    --env "HUGGING_FACE_HUB_TOKEN=<secret>" \
    -p 8000:8000 \
    --ipc=host \
    vllm/vllm-openai:latest \
    --model lianghsun/Llama-3.2-Taiwan-3B-Instruct --revision <tag_name>
```

#### Training Hyperparameters

<details>
  <summary><b>SFT stage for v2024.11.27</b></summary>

  **Note:** 以下包含 `v2024.11.22``v2025.11.25` 的超參數設定
  - **learning_rate:** 5e-05
  - **min_learning_rate:** 5e-07
  - **train_batch_size:** 105
  - **seed:** 42
  - **distributed_type:** multi-GPU
  - **num_devices:** 4
  - **gradient_accumulation_steps:** 50
  - **total_train_batch_size:** 21,000
  - **optimizer:** Adam with betas=(0.9,0.999) and epsilon=1e-08
  - **lr_scheduler_type:** cosine
  - **lr_scheduler_warmup_ratio:** 0.01
  - **num_epochs:** 5.0
  - **global_step:** 590
</details>

#### Speeds, Sizes, Times

<!-- This section provides information about throughput, start/end time, checkpoint size if relevant, etc. -->
<details>
  <summary><b>SFT stage for v2024.11.27</b></summary>

  **Note:** 以下包含 `v2024.11.22` 和 `v2025.11.25` 的超參數設定
  - **Duration**: 5 days, 16:15:11.17
  - **Train runtime**: 490,511.1789
  - **Train samples per second**: 25.37
  - **Train steps per second**: 0.001
  - **Total training FLOPs**: 26,658,386,120,540,160
  - **Train loss**: 0.8533
</details>
